Abstract:
We consider the problem of reconstructing three components of wind velocity from measurement data of the radial component along directions uniformly located on the surface of a vertical cone using the least squares method. Estimates are obtained for the maximum error in the reconstruction of each component of the wind speed vector and for the mean square errors in the asymptotic approximation. Estimates are obtained taking into account the completeness of measurement data.
